Auto diagnosis refers to the process of identifying and analyzing vehicle problems using specialized diagnostic tools and systems. These systems are designed to scan your vehicle's electronic components and systems to detect issues, from engine malfunctions to transmission problems. By plugging into a vehicle's On-Board Diagnostic (OBD) system, auto diagnosis tools can communicate with the vehicle's computer, allowing mechanics to pinpoint the source of any issues efficiently.
Auto diagnosis systems work by connecting to a car’s computer using a diagnostic tool. These systems retrieve data from the vehicle’s sensors and modules, identifying trouble codes that indicate potential problems. The diagnostic tool then displays these codes, which the mechanic or technician can interpret to determine the exact issue. This streamlined process saves time compared to traditional manual inspections, allowing for quicker and more accurate problem identification.
